GFCI outlets, or Ground Fault Circuit Interrupters, are crucial components of modern electrical installations, especially in areas prone to moisture, such as bathrooms. Their primary function is to prevent electrical shock by quickly cutting off power when they detect an imbalance between incoming and outgoing electricity. This enhanced safety feature makes them mandatory in locations where water and electricity are in close proximity.

Code Requirements for GFCI Outlets
The National Electrical Code (NEC) plays a pivotal role in dictating how many GFCI outlets are necessary in bathrooms. According to current standards, “all outlets within six feet of a sink” must be GFCI protected. Hence, when planning electrical installations in a bathroom, it’s critical to understand distances involving water sources since this can affect the number of GFCI units you may need.
Determining the Number of Outlets
The actual number of GFCI outlets required in a bathroom can vary based on the bathroom’s design and size. Typically, a standard bathroom should have at least one GFCI outlet placed within close reach of sink areas. However, larger or more complex bathrooms might require multiple outlets, especially if there are separate vanities, multiple sinks, or additional features like steam showers or whirlpool tubs.

Backup Options for Bathrooms
Sometimes, the situation calls for more than just standard GFCI outlets. For rooms with particularly high electrical demands, you might consider dedicated GFCI circuits. This means that instead of relying solely on the outlets, you install a GFCI circuit breaker which will provide protection to an entire circuit, enabling multiple outlets to be protected simultaneously. This setup can be incredibly beneficial for larger bathrooms with multiple electrical devices.

Maintenance of GFCI Outlets
Just because you’ve installed the necessary GFCI outlets doesn’t mean your job is over. Regular maintenance is vital for ensuring they remain functional. It’s a good idea to test these outlets monthly by pressing the “test” and “reset” buttons. This simple act can save you from unforeseen dangers by ensuring everything is in proper working order.
